THE FMOS-COSMOS SURVEY OF STAR-FORMING GALAXIES AT z ∼ 1.6 II. THE MASS-METALLICITY RELATION AND THE DEPENDENCE ON STAR FORMATION RATE AND DUST EXTINCTION
We investigate the relationships between stellar mass, gas-phase oxygen abundance (metallicity), star formation rate, and dust content of star-forming galaxies at z∼1.6 using Subaru/FMOS spectroscopy in the COSMOS field. The mass-metallicity relation at z ∼ 1.6 is steeper than the relation observed in the local Universe. The steeper MZ relation at z ∼ 1.6 is mainly due to evolution in the stell...

متن کاملThe near-IR luminosity-metallicity relationship for dwarf irregular galaxies
We briefly describe our on-going investigation of the near-IR luminosity-metallicity relationship for dwarf irregular galaxies in nearby groups of galaxies. The motivations of the project and the observational databases are introduced, and a preliminary result is presented. The 12 + log(O/H) vs. H plane must be populated with more low-luminosity galaxies before a definite conclusion can be drawn.
